FT Vest US Equity Buffer ETF September

87 hedge funds and large institutions have $122M invested in FT Vest US Equity Buffer ETF September in 2023 Q3 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 20 funds opening new positions, 31 increasing their positions, 21 reducing their positions, and 9 closing their positions.
